description Auralic Aries G2.1 Overview
The Auralic Aries G2.1 is a network audio transport manufactured by Auralic, a company founded in China in 2009. The device is designed to stream digital audio from network sources to an external digital-to-analog converter and incorporates the company's proprietary Tesla processing platform. It is marketed to the audiophile segment and is part of Auralic's G2 product line.
help Auralic Aries G2.1 FAQ
Does the Auralic Aries G2.1 have a built-in DAC?
No, the Aries G2.1 is strictly a network audio transport, meaning it streams digital music but does not decode it internally. It must be connected to an external digital-to-analog converter (DAC) to process the audio into a signal your amplifier can play.
What processing platform powers the Auralic Aries G2.1?
It uses Auralic's proprietary Tesla platform, which is built around a specialized quad-core processor. This hardware allows the device to handle demanding tasks like high-resolution PCM and DSD streaming without jitter.
When was the Auralic Aries G2.1 released?
The G2.1 series, which includes this network transport, was introduced in the late 2010s. It served as an upgraded, heavier version of the original G2 platform, featuring improved chassis dampening and internal components.
What streaming services are supported by the Aries G2.1?
The device integrates directly with Auralic's Lightning DS app, which provides native support for platforms like Qobuz, Tidal, and Amazon Music. It is also Roon Ready, allowing seamless integration into a larger Roon audio ecosystem.
